Any rule or portion of a rule, as that term is defined in section 536.010, that is created under the authority delegated in sections 261.230 to 261.239 shall become effective only if they comply with and are subject to all of the provisions of chapter 536 and if applicable, section 536.028. These sections and chapter 536 are nonseverable and if any of the powers vested with the general assembly pursuant to chapter 536 to review, to delay the effective date, or to disapprove and annul a rule are subsequently held unconstitutional, then the grant of rulemaking authority and any rule proposed or adopted after August 28, 2001, shall be invalid and void.
